Byondis is an independent Dutch biopharmaceutical company, based in Nijmegen, that focuses on developing innovative medicines against cancer and autoimmune diseases. We are driven by one goal: to develop new treatments to improve the standard of care for patients.
Within the Byondis CMC department we develop our processes from cell line development up to Drug Product and we have our own in house GMP manufacturing facilities to produce monoclonal Antibodies (mAbs) and Antibody Drug Conjugates (ADCs) for our clinical needs.
